With the increase of the UK minimum wage, Jersey and Guernsey have followed suit, leaving the Isle of Man lagging behind.
According to the Jersey Evening Post, Guernsey is set to increase its minimum wage to £9.05 an hour, with Jersey proposing theirs be brought up to £9.22.
The Island's minimum wage currently stands at £8.25, with Tynwald approving a recommendation earlier this year to bring it in line with the living wage in the next five years.
Manx Labour Party members, MHKs Sarah Maltby and Joney Faragher are pushing for this to happen sooner.
